.elementor-1430 .elementor-element.elementor-element-2e28dad{--display:flex;--margin-top:-50px;--margin-bottom:0px;--margin-left:0px;--margin-right:0px;}.elementor-1430 .elementor-element.elementor-element-8af5296{--display:flex;}/* Start custom CSS for html, class: .elementor-element-cfc2b76 */h1, h2, h3, h4, h5, h6 {
  position: relative;
  display: inline-block;
  cursor: pointer;
  transition: color 0.3s ease, transform 0.2s ease, text-shadow 0.3s ease;
}

/* Hover Effects */
h1:hover, h2:hover, h3:hover, h4:hover, h5:hover, h6:hover {
  color: #0073e6; /* Blue hover color */
  transform: translateX(5px); /* Slight move */
  text-shadow: 0 0 8px rgba(0,115,230,0.6); /* Glow effect */
}

/* Underline Animation */
h1::after, h2::after, h3::after, h4::after, h5::after, h6::after {
  content: "";
  position: absolute;
  left: 0;
  bottom: -4px;
  width: 0;
  height: 2px;
  background: #0073e6;
  transition: width 0.3s ease;
}

h1:hover::after, h2:hover::after, h3:hover::after, 
h4:hover::after, h5:hover::after, h6:hover::after {
  width: 100%;
}/* End custom CSS */